We took the tour when we stayed there in 2003. It was relatively painless, and we received a discount on park tickets as our gift (we probably could have chosen something else, but that was what we wanted). We got 2 adult/2 children one day admission tickets for MK, and I think we paid about $80. It was a savings of $120, I believe, so it was worth it for us.
